Hi All,

Sorry to ask this here, but I suspect this may be one of the best places to find an answer.  I have a set of SF2 files I created for my E-mu samplers and now I want to support my Akai S950.  I read the S950 supports S1000 programs and samples, so I converted my SF2 files to program.p and sample.s files.  Assuming these files will work with the S950, the next thing I need to do is put the files in a .akai image file.  That's where I'm stuck.

Has anyone made Akai S950 image files from SF2 files and is willing to share?
